What is aviation English?

Aviation Englishrefers to the specific English used in the field of aviation, which can be found in radio communications between pilots and controllers as well as in technical documentation, briefings, procedures, and operations in an international environment.

Unlike general English, this language followsspecific codes,codified terminology, andoperational logicthat is essential for ensuring simple, clear, and unambiguous communication.

Aviation English is based on two complementary pillars:

  1. Standardized phraseology established by the International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O) and used in radio communications.
  2. Non-phrasology aviation English, necessary for non-radio communication: briefings, crew coordination, document analysis, handling unusual situations, technical understanding, etc.

For pilots, air traffic controllers, and all aviation professionals, mastering Aviation English is not just an asset: it is anoperational necessity, linked to safety and performance in a highly technical and international field.

 

 

Why is aviation English essential?

Security and communication: a major challenge

Aeronautics relies on standardized, unambiguous communication. Misinterpretation or misunderstanding can lead to critical errors—which is why Aviation English is strictly codified.

Good control allows you to:

  • to use thecorrect phrasing, without improvisation or approximation
  • understand different accents, varying speech rates, or noisy environments
  • to handle unusual or emergency situationscalmly and accurately
  • to effectively coordinate decisions within the crew or with the control tower

In an international context where pilots and air traffic controllers may be of different nationalities, this common language is a key factor inflight safety.

Skills covered in Aviation English

Aviation English encompasses a wide range of specific skills:

✔️ Aviation phraseology: Correct and fluent use of ICAO standardized messages.

✔️ Listening comprehension: ATC listening , real traffic, international accents, fast-paced information.

✔️ Operational communication: Non-phraseological interactions : crew coordination, briefings, abnormal situations.

✔️ Technical vocabulary: Terminology related to aircraft, procedures, weather, navigation, safety, NOTAM, etc.

✔️ Appropriate grammatical structures: Ability to express oneself clearly, accurately, and concisely.

✔️ Interaction and fluency: Responsiveness , spontaneity, organization of speech in realistic situations.
